[Edit]There are some real rarities on Vol. 13 of this superlative twenty-LP series. Guitarist Django Reinhardt is heard during the worst war years leading his Quintet of the Hot Club of France (which in addition to its usual clarinetist Hubert Rostaing, features clarinetists Andre Lluis and Gerald Leveque on several tracks), heading a couple of big bands and taking two unaccompanied solos on "Improvisation No. 3." Fortunately this exciting music is now available on a ten-CD box set put out by EMI.
